Housing in DeKalb County
Both Census and HUD figures represent gross rent — contract rent plus estimated utility costs for electricity, heat, water, and sewer.
Rent in DeKalb County averages $1,692/month for a 2‑bedroom in 2024, compared to the Georgia median of $1,393 and the national median of $1,413. Local renters spend approximately 37% of household income on rent, above the national average of 32%.
HUD 2026 50th Percentile Rent Estimates for DeKalb County FMR Area are $1,739 for a studio, $1,821 for 1‑bedroom, $1,996 for 2‑bedroom, $2,393 for 3‑bedroom, and $2,857 for 4‑bedroom.
HUD 2026 Rent Estimates reflect market movement since 2024 Census data — a $304 increase for a 2-bedroom in DeKalb County shows a 18% rise over that period.
The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ics annual unemployment rate for DeKalb County was 3.7% in 2024, compared to Georgia at 3.5% and the national rate of 4.0%.
